Dress for Success aimed to elevate its Women Who Inspire campaign into a high-visibility, national initiative that would amplify its mission of empowering women globally. The Brand Agency was brought on to develop and execute a 360º media strategy that would generate buzz ahead of the March 1 launch. The goal: curate an influential committee, secure high-profile media placements, and drive engagement through press, social media, and strategic partnerships.

The Brand Agency formed an Inspire Committee of powerful voices aligned with Dress for Success’ mission, including Shay Mitchell, Yara Shahidi, Whitney Port, and Sunny Hostin, and celebrity stylists like Allison Bornstein and Micaela Erlanger. A multi-channel rollout, beginning with an embargoed press release to national outlets, was paired with custom social content and coordinated posts from Committee members. The campaign secured product donations from brands like Eternal Water and BÉIS Luggage to support key events.

The results spoke volumes: the Women Who Inspire campaign generated over 1.37 billion total media impressions and 63.33 million social media impressions, with major press placements in Entertainment Tonight, OK! Magazine, E! News, and IMDb, alongside local coverage from CTV News and Arizona Family. The campaign’s reach translated to an estimated $34.45 million in media value and $1.58 million in social value. With sustained storytelling and celebrity amplification, the initiative reached audiences nationwide, solidifying Dress for Success’s place as a leader in female empowerment.
